| Saydee's Sporty
Last month I wan't to get more drive time at our local comp so I threw together some parts I had to make a sporty. It was a bast!!! First Course my rear four link came of the axle. I didn't take a repair just said screw it and drove. It did great. But after I got home it hit me. I am building a real Sporty. I loved this sportsman class. Chassis:VP Incision Chassis MOA mod to fit trans Transmission: Axial ax10 transmission with Robinson Racing gears Shocks: Axial SCX10 with JeepinDoug caps. Losi Blue and Green springs Axial: Axial AR60 Front RCP locker Overdrive and Tube Vanquish Chub Vanquish Wraith Knuckles Rear Die-Laughing spool Underdrive Vanquish Lockouts Driveline: Axial wild boars Links: Rear Wraith Vanquish ti lowers all rest Ti straights. Wheels: DE Racing with 335 front 225 rear. Tires: Shaved Losi Claw Dinky servo mount Rowdy Racing Lipo Tray. Front still needs the good gears |

I almost just sent you my narrow stuff, and used your uncut axles. I narrowed mine, and really wish I had not. I ended up going with a wider hex to get the width I wanted. The biggest reason I did it was the axle plates were made for narrowed axles. Otherwise, I think with a reasonably offset wheel, you are OK. | |

Looks like you'll have fun with that truck. I was just looking at an old C10 to throw on my new build too. At first I didn't think my truck was too wide with full width Wraith axles, but at the WCS it was a tad too wide. And I had skinny wheels DNA wheels. It was stable as hell but just a bit to wide to navigate some sections. The width didn't kill my day though. Last edited by TSK; 03-26-2013 at 06:03 PM. |
